Description

Welcome to 14 Partlands Avenue

Set behind a traditional exterior, 14 Partlands Avenue is a wonderfully distinctive detached chalet bungalow offering a rare combination of space, personality and lifestyle appeal. The accommodation has been styled with exceptional flair, creating an interior that feels bold, creative and memorable from the moment you step inside. At the heart of the home is a superb double-height entrance hall with a vaulted ceiling and dormer window, establishing a real sense of drama and light. From here, the layout flows beautifully into a series of sociable living spaces, including a characterful kitchen/breakfast room, dining room, sitting room, snug and sunroom, each with its own atmosphere and connection to the garden. With three generous double bedrooms, two bathrooms, a study, utility room, garage and an insulated garden pod, the property is both hugely practical and highly adaptable, offering scope for family living, entertaining, working from home or further refinement by a new owner.

Situated in the popular Swanmore area, Partlands Avenue enjoys a convenient position within easy reach of Ryde’s wide range of amenities, including boutique shops, supermarkets, cafés, restaurants and everyday services. The town is also well regarded for its sandy beaches and esplanade, where high-speed passenger links connect the Island with the mainland. Families are well served by local schooling at both primary and secondary level, while regular bus services and the Island Line train line provide useful connections across the Island. The Fishbourne to Portsmouth car ferry service is also within easy reach, making this a well-placed home for those seeking a stylish Island lifestyle with straightforward travel links.
